All DBPR Inspector Observations

21 full violation description(s) documented by the inspector during this visit.

High Priority 9

#10High Priority22-41-4

High Priority – Dishmachine chlorine sanitizer not at proper minimum strength. Discontinue use of dishmachine for sanitizing and set up manual sanitization until dishmachine is repaired and sanitizing properly. Dishwasher (Chlorine 0ppm) **Repeat Violation**

Repeat Violation
#11High Priority03A-02-4

High Priority – Potentially hazardous (time/temperature control for safety) food cold held at greater than 41 degrees Fahrenheit. In upper part of make table sliced turkey (54°F – Cold Holding); sliced ham (52°F – Cold Holding); sliced provolone (48°F – Cold Holding). Gap in front of chicken salad container releasing cold air. In lower cabinet of make table shredded cheddar blend (47°F – Cold Holding); hot dogs (51°F – Cold Holding).

#12High Priority01B-38-4

High Priority – Potentially hazardous (time/temperature control for safety) food not cooled from ambient temperature to 41 degrees Fahrenheit within four hours. See stop sale. cut tomatoes at 12:23 initially cut at 9:30 (53°F – Cooling at 1:49 51°F)

Stop Sale
#13High Priority03D-06-4

High Priority – Potentially hazardous (time/temperature control for safety) food prepared from/mixed with ingredient(s) at ambient temperature not cooled to 41 degrees Fahrenheit within 4 hours. cut tomatoes at 12:23 from 9:30 (53°F – Cooling at 1:49 51°F)

#14High Priority35A-09-4

High Priority – Presence of insects, rodents, or other pests. 1 dead flying insect on shelf with clean pitchers. 3 dead flying insects on shelf with bagged sugar, rice, gravy mix, and flour. Dead insect in low crevice on floor by kitchen door to banquet room. At least 10 dead insects in Window behind dish machine.

#15High Priority35A-23-4

High Priority – Roach excrement and/or droppings present. 2 roach droppings on floor behind speed rack to left of three compartment sink. At least 3 roach droppings on floor under/behind three compartment sink.

#16High Priority35A-04-4

High Priority – Rodent activity present as evidenced by rodent droppings found. At least 1 soft moist and 7 dry crumbly rodent droppings in cabinet under hand-wash sink by office near exit door dorm kitchen to bar lobby. 2 dry crumbly rodent droppings on floor behind ice machine at top of stairs. 9 firm to dry crumbly rodent droppings under floor of clean side of dish machine drain board near rolling shelf to left of drain board. 1 shiny moist rodent dropping on floor under clean drainboard. Floor not wet, but buildup of greasy accumulation on floor in area. 1 firm rodent dropping on floor under dish machine. At least 25 dry crumbly rodent droppings in cabinet under hand-wash sink at bar. 50 firm rodent droppings in locked bar cabinet to right of hand-wash sink at bar. Evidence of chew marks on wrapper for chocolate candy in locked cabinet at bar. 1 firm shiny rodent dropping and 20 dry crumbly rodent droppings on under counter shelf with clean glasses. At least 10dry crumbly rodent droppings on floor along wall that runs downstairs from walk-in freezer behind washing machine and dry to water heater. In downstairs dry storage room in box of wrapped pasta 8 dry crumbly rodent droppings. 3 dry crumbly rodent droppings stuck to seat pads sitting on shelf in dry storage. At least 25 dry crumbly rodent droppings on shelf directly by dried pasta. At least 25 additional dry crumbly rodent droppings on other dry storage shelves.
